“Rocks “Saturday Night Fever is a five yo. Registered chocolate Rocky Mountain mare that stands at 14.2 HH.
Disposition:
Rocks is a joy to be around, with a kind, willing attitude, and unflappable abilities. Chilled personality! She will come to you when called from the pasture and in your pocket kind of girl. Loves attention- treats-scratches!! In winter, she is a deep chocolate; in summer, here in Texas, she lightens up with beautiful dapple spots. Just simply gorgeous!
Ground accolades:
Ties up quietly to anything (trees/post/rails) plus ground ties for grooming (stands still while being groomed), loves baths! Saddles and bridles easily (lowers her head). Round pen: lunges with and without lead rope/flexes well/ desensitized to flags/balls/tarp/swinging rope in the air above her head/ balloons. Stands well for vets and farriers. She is barefoot with great feet, regularly trimmed. Trailers great-loading and calmly unloading.
Riding:
She is a fabulous trail horse—will cross water, various terrain, and will go slow and easily. She will ride into a lake, ride out alone or with other horses, and doesn’t mind leading or following. She has a wonderful, smooth 4-beat gait. She has an easy canter, will lead change, and is all very relaxed. She will side pass and open/close gates. She knows how to move over to a mounting block on cue and will mount from any object (picnic tables/logs/back of pick up/ side by side). She knows neck reins and moves off of leg pressure. She has no vices and is easy to handle in every way. She has been around cars and busy highways, will walk through Dairy Queen, and will wait patiently while the order is being processed. She can ride bareback as well. She will go up into a gazebo, walk on narrow sidewalks, up and down concrete steps, walk over any bridge (wide or narrow /long or short and elevated), and greet new people in parks, children, and animals. She is not bothered by bicycles, motorcycles, flags (riding with or going by them), exotic deer, zebras, charging dogs, farm equipment, loud trucks, etc.…. unflappable!
Training:
I originally purchased her from a Rocky Mountain breeder/trainer in Kentucky. After being with me for a while, I sent her to complete a two-month performance western training. After many months, I sent her to complete a tune-up with a gaited horse trainer who greatly improved her four-beat gait and softness to the harness. She is up to date with Coggins/shots.
